PROFESSIONAL PROFILE
Jan Huang is a Vice President who has been with Merrill Lynch since 1991. She holds a BS degree from Clemson University in South Carolina, a MS degree from Rutgers in New Jersey, and an MA degree from Central Michigan University. Jan specializes in the development and implementation of wealth creation and maintenance strategies, with regard to personal and business assets. Her clients include national and international, small and medium-sized businesses, business owners, as well as other individuals concerned about retirement and wealth solutions in today's economic enviornment.
